620 Ω resistor colour code

Four bands: Blue · Red · Brown · Gold. The first two give the digits, the third multiplies, the fourth states how far off the real part may be.

The same value on a five-band part

Precision resistors carry three significant digits instead of two, so the same 620 Ω looks different.
